Is Exmouth Brixington safer than Newquay Suburbs?
Exmouth Brixington has a safety score of 56/100 (Average) and recorded 336 crimes in the last 12 months. Newquay Suburbs has a safety score of 11/100 (High Crime) with 1,091 crimes. Exmouth Brixington scores higher on the CrimeRadar safety index.
What is the crime trend in Exmouth Brixington vs Newquay Suburbs?
Exmouth Brixington shows a year-on-year crime trend of -17.7% — meaning total crimes fell compared to the same period the prior year. Newquay Suburbs shows -16.3% (falling). A downward trend is a positive sign for an area.

How does anti-social behaviour compare between Exmouth Brixington and Newquay Suburbs?
Exmouth Brixington recorded 48 anti-social behaviour incidents in the last 12 months, while Newquay Suburbs recorded 140. Anti-social behaviour includes rowdiness, nuisance and disorder that disrupts daily life but may not result in a criminal charge.
How do violent crime levels compare in Exmouth Brixington vs Newquay Suburbs?
Violent crime in Exmouth Brixington totalled 152 incidents over the last 12 months, compared to 505 in Newquay Suburbs. Violent crime includes assault with and without injury, harassment, and public order offences.

What is the resolution rate for crimes in Exmouth Brixington and Newquay Suburbs?
The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Exmouth Brixington has a resolution rate of 20.4% and Newquay Suburbs has 23.7%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

What data is used to compare Exmouth Brixington and Newquay Suburbs?
C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
